November 2nd and 3rd - Hand Building with Slabs: Stretching Possibilities With Scott Jennings

$350.00

In this two day hands-on workshop, Scott Jennings will demonstrate the techniques that he uses to create hand built vessels from slabs of clay. He will show how to make patterns for each form, how to texture the clay, best practices for constructing with slabs, and how to create volume by stretching the vessels once constructed. Glazing considerations will also be discussed. This workshop would be appropriate for students who have some hand building experience.

The workshop will run Saturday and Sunday, November 2nd and 3rd 10-3pm.

Students will create up to 2 pieces in this workshop that will be bisqued for students to pick up 3-4 weeks after the workshop.

All material will be provided.

Scott Jennings is a Bay Area artist who has been working with clay for 30 years. He has 15+ years of teaching experience in various settings including community college, municipal arts programs, and community studios. Scott has worked as a college ceramic lab technician and production manager at a ceramics manufacturing facility. He graduated with a BFA in Ceramics from Cal State Fullerton in 1996. He maintains a workspace in San Francisco at 1890 Bryant Studios.
